Paul Storiale and Fulton Entertainment present the much anticipated Los Angeles return of THE GAYEST CHRISTMAS PAGEANT EVER! written by Joe Marshall and co-directed by Paul Storiale and Bree Pavey. Tonight, December 5th to December 27th. The show runs Fridays/Saturdays at 8pm; Sundays -- date and times vary. Check the website for date, times and tickets available. Tickets are $20 and can be purchased by visiting www.ChristmasFarce.com. The Whitmore Lindley Theatre Center is located at 11006 Magnolia Blvd., NoHo Arts District 91601.

The cast includes the talents of Bri Amazoudeh, Chase Cargill, Milton David, Jennifer Eagle, Eljaye, Marco Estrada, AB Farrelly, John Hayden, Matt Larson, Moremi Okoroh, Skip Pipo, Charles-Curtis Sanders, Adam Serafino, Page Smith, Brian Spengel, Morgan Stephens, and Lindsay Stetson.

The NoHo Arts District will be a buzzin' as 20 actors play nearly 40 characters in a Christmas spectacular that will get you in the holiday mood. No one escapes unscathed as Joe Marshall's fast-paced holiday comedy. THE GAYEST CHRISTMAS PAGEANT EVER! follows a small gay community theatre as they struggle to pull together their annual holiday pageant. This is a holiday show with all the fixins': Santa, Jesus, a couple of wise men, an inn-keeper, an angry black man, a racist and its fair share of drama queens all gathering together to make this the best, gayest Christmas ever!

About his play, Joe Marshall says; "While a couple of the characters are gay, this really is a play for everyone with straight, African American, gay, lesbian, Christian, Jewish, young and old characters. Just come prepared to laugh and not take yourself too seriously!"
